@SunsetRunner WavyDavey is right, there currently isn't a way to edit the name of your Charge 2 in your Bluetooth settings.

This shouldn't be an issue though since Bluetooth bonding is done through the Fitbit App, not through your Bluetooth settings.

To put it another way, you pair a tracker through the app, not the phones Bluetooth search. 

To accidentally connect to another person's fitbit you would need to first accidentally log into their Fitbit account instead of your Fitbit account. 

 

Renaming a Bluetooth device, if it is possible, would be done through your phones Bluetooth settings

You can change the name on your devices Settings.

Open up Connections, then Bluetooth, then select the settings icon next to the device you wish to change the name of. Select Rename and change as required.

I don't know, it does work on android. However your not changing the Bluetooth id of the Charge 2. Your simply changing the reference name on the blue tooth trusted device list.
